We are seeking a Technical Program Manager with a passion for healthcare innovation and experience managing complex data-driven product portfolios. You will play a key leadership role in ensuring our clinical registry products meet user needs, regulatory standards, and the highest performance benchmarks. This role requires technical fluency, program oversight, cross-functional coordination, and a deep commitment to quality and continuous improvement.
As TPM for Clinical Registries, you will drive the end-to-end lifecycle of multiple registry implementations. Youāll collaborate with engineering, product, abstractors, researchers, and external stakeholders to scope enhancements, monitor quality, and continually improve user experience and abstraction accuracy. Youāll also champion analytical rigor and root cause investigation, helping us iterate and evolve our AI-enabled solutions.
Responsibilities:
Product Management & Cross-functional Collaboration
- Collaborate with engineering, product management, research, sales, and customer success to define product requirements and timelines for clinical registry solutions.
- Synthesize complex registry requirements into clear, actionable user stories and documentation for product enhancements.
- Conduct user interviews and observe abstractor workflows to gather feedback and prioritize iterative improvements.
- Manage concurrent timelines for multiple clinical registry implementations, ensuring consistent delivery and roadmap alignment.
Continuous Improvement & Quality Culture
- Track key performance indicators (KPIs) using analytics dashboards to identify opportunities for improvement across accuracy, coverage, and throughput.
- Lead structured root cause analyses and process mapping to identify workflow friction, abstraction errors, and failure modes.
- Design and implement Plan-Do-Study-Act (PDSA) cycles to pilot changes and assess impact.
- Promote a culture of data stewardship, continuous learning, and accountability across product and engineering teams.
Data Analysis, QA, and Performance Measurement
- Develop, track, and communicate metrics around AI-assisted abstraction quality, coverage, and accuracy
- Partner with QA and ML teams to categorize error types and failure modes, and suggest targeted improvements to models or workflows.
- Participate in validation and verification efforts to ensure abstraction outputs meet clinical and operational standards.
